Summary

Dr. Sylvain Doré is a former University of Florida professor and neuroscientist running for the Florida Senate in . His platform focuses on making Florida more affordable, safe, and accessible through public service.

Key Facts

  • Sylvain Doré is a candidate for the Florida Senate representing District 9.
  • Doré is a former professor of Anesthesiology and Neuroscience at the University of Florida.
  • Doré served on the University of Florida Board of Trustees for thirteen years.
  • The candidate is a registered Democrat.
  • The candidate's stated policy goals include increasing state affordability, safety, and accessibility.
  • The candidate's professional background includes work in medicine, real estate, and philanthropy.
  • The candidate's campaign logo incorporates imagery of a brain to symbolize intellect and innovation.
